  • 2000년 문제들을 조기에 해결하고자 총무처에서 "행정정보화촉진시행계획('96-2000)"에 컴퓨터 2000년 연도표기 문제에 대처하는 사업을 반영시켰고, '97년 5월에 "컴퓨터 2000년 연도표기문제 처리지침"을 마련하여 각 부처에 시달하였으며, 동 지침을 실무자들이 수행하는데 이해를 돕기 위하여 지침에 대한 해설서를 작성하여 '97년 7월 각 부처에 송부하였다. 이 글에서는 동 지침을 중심으로 행정부문의 Y2K(2000년)현황과 대책을 소개한다.

  • The purpose of this study is to consider practical examples of the method of utilizing plant material 'lotus' used by the ancients, and the value and meaning they wanted to get from it. The method of this study to do this is descriptive study to consider and interpret poem and painting reflecting impression and concept world of lotus. Summary of this study is as follows. First, ornamental value of lotus could be divided in effect of group plant and detail value held by the flower, the leaves and the stem. Especially, group plant lotus in large site provides unique landscape differentiated form other flowering plants. As well, another feature of lotus is its high ornamental value spread in detail elements including the flower, the leaves, the stem and the lotus seed. Second, fragrance expressed 'Hyang-won-ik-cheong(香遠益淸)' is an important charm of lotus. Lotus was utilized as olfactory element providing fragrance. The ancients considered lotus fragrance not only for enjoy but as symbolic object comparing noble man's dignity so that they expressed it in poem and painting. Third, lotus was utilized as acoustical element. That is, the sound of raindrops harmonizing the surface of water and wide lotus leaves was called 'hearing lotus fond and rain', enjoying it as classic grace. Fourth, summer play lotus sightseeing was called mind wash up meaning 'washing the mind polluted by the mundane world'. Such poetic taste was widely enjoyed by various classes from general public to royal family. Besides, poetic taste related with lotus is the method of drinking alcohol using the feature of big lotus leave and vacant stem, called 'Beog-tong-ju(碧筒酒)'. And in the Joseon dynasty period, when the distinction between the man and the woman influenced by Confucian, lotus seed and 'lotus collecting song' was important sign to express romance between man and woman. Lotus has been enamored by wide classes transcending cultural background as thought and religion since ancient times.   • 이 논문은 한국어 파열연자음이 유성음 환경에서 유성음화하는 현상을 운율구조와 관련해서 음향음성학적으로 고찰하는 것을 목적으로 한다. 이 논문에서는 첫째, 음성적 자질로서나 청각적인 판단에 의해서나 무성음과 유성음의 이분법으로 나뉘는 것을 음향적 고찰을 통하여 각각을 하위의 범주로 나누었다. 문장 안에서 파열연자음이 음향적으로 실현될 때 각각의 범주가 어느 정도의 빈도수로 출현하는지를 살펴보았다. 둘째, 한국어 파열연자음은 어절 초에서는 무성음으로 실현되나 앞뒤에 유성음이 오는 경우에는 유성화되는 음운규칙이 있는데, 음향적인 분석을 통하여 앞뒤에 유성음이 온다는 조건만으로 설명할 수 없는 예들을 발견하였다. 그리하여 인접음절(특히 앞음절에 오는 분절음의 특성)과 운율구조(액센트구 내에서의 위치, 억양구경계의 유무)를 함께 고려하는 파열연자음 유성화규칙의 조건을 제안하였다.

  • 40nm의 해상도를 갖는 연 X-선 결상현미경 시스템의 광학계를 결정하였다. 연 X-선 장치에서의 대물렌즈로써 대상시료내에 빔 초점(focusing)를 위한 광학계로 두개의 Ellipsoid형 광하계로 설계하였다. 또한 접안렌즈로는 Fresnel zone plate로 하여 설계 및 제작하였다. 또한 연 X-선이 지나가는 빔 경로 상에 놓여진 다양한 물질들에 대한 각각의 X-선 광자의 조사선량을 계산하였다. 살아있는 세포를 관찰하고자하는 본 장치의 목적에 부합되기 위한 세포가 피폭되는 임계 방사선 조사선량의 관점에서 연 X-선의 선원의 세기와 검출기의 증폭효율을 고찰하였다.

  • It has been studied that a variety of fauna and flora are sensitive biological indicators which reflect the severity of regional pollution of heavy metals, but in the center of part of Taegu City the controversial issue of lead poisoning attributable to the atmosphere which contains an increased concentrations of lead has been raised recently, it is usually hard to find suitable plants or animal in the areas with heavy traffic. Pigeons are ubiquitous in and around Taegu City area, inhabiting even the most densely populated areas with heavy traffic. With its small body size, high metabolic turnover, and rather limited mobility, a pigeon, as a biological indicator is expected. This study was conducted to monitor lead pollution in the Taegu and Kyongju City in Korea. We measured the lead content of the various tissue of three groups of feral pigeon(Columba livia) and soil and atmospheric lead concentration. First group was obtained in heavy traffic area in Taegu City, the second group was obtained a park in Taegu City and the third group was obtained light traffic area in Kyongju City. The air and soil lead concentration of heavy traffic area in Taegu City was $0.11{\mu}g/m^3,\;4.96{\mu}g/g$, that of park in Taegu City was $0.05{\mu}g/m^3,\;2.65{\mu}g/g$ and that of light traffic area in Kyongju City was $0.03{\mu}g/m^3,\;0.01{\mu}g/g$. The lead content of lung, blood, kidney, femur and liver of feral pigeons in heavy traffic area in Taegu City was significantly higher than pigeons obtained in a park in Taegu City and low traffic density area in Kyongju City(p<0.01). But stomach lead content of three group did not reflect a significant difference. In this study positive correlation was found between atmospheric lead concentrations and the concentration of lead in the pigeon's lung(r=0.5040, p<0.001), blood(r=0.3322, p<0.01), kidney(r=0.4824, p<0.001), femur(r=0.7214, p<0.001) and liver(r=0.4836, p<0.01). We can also found positive correlation between soil lead concentrations and the concentration of lead in the pigeon's femur(r=0.4850, p<0.001), kidney(r=0.4850, p<0.001) and liver(r=0.4386, p<0.01). In the pigeon's tissue there were significant correlations between concentration of lead in the blood and kidney(r=4818, p<0.001), femur(r=0.6157, p<0.001) and liver(r=0.3889, p<0.001). In conclusion, at the heavy traffic area in Taegu City, lead concentrations found in the atmosphere and soil are reflected in the lead concentrations of different tissue of urban pigeons. It is suggested that the tissue of pigeons can be good biological indicators of environmental lead pollution.

  • A shear connection in composite bridges with precast decks has considerable characteristics different from cast-in-place deck bridges such as shear pocket and bedding layer. Thus, it is necessary to build design basis of the shear connector in precast decks through the experiments. In order to estimate fatigue life of shear connector in precast deck bridges, push-out fatigue tests were conducted with parameter, bedding layer thickness. As a result of the tests, failure modes of shear connector were observed. Consequently, empirical S-N curve equations of stud shear connector in precast deck bridges were proposed in this paper.

  • In this paper, the equilibrium flight conditions of a Korean Traditional Bangpae Kite with low aspect ratio were analyzed by it's aerodynamic data of wind tunnel test. The data of aerodynamic forces and center of pressure of the Kite were used to calculate the relative length of bridles to satisfy the condition of settling the kite to the static equilibrium steady state between ${\theta}=30^{\circ}{\sim}60^{\circ}$. From this equilibrium flight performance analysis, we obtained ($0.88{\pm}0.02$)c of the rear bridle length corresponding to 0.88c of fixed front bridle length. These results were exact agreement with the relative bridle lengths by Korean classical method.

  • The article presents a parametric study on geometrical design optimization for coupling the joint between a large exhaust air chimney and electromagnetic pulse (EMP) shield for gas turbine electricity generator. We conducted computational fluid dynamics (CFD) simulations on hydraulic diameters of waveguide below cutoff(WBC) ranges 800mm~1025mm, the connection distance ranges 150~450mm, and exhaust gas flow velocities at 15, 20, and 25m/s. The results show that the diameter of main chimney, connection distance, and exhaust gas velocity had impacts on flow stream at the EMP shield. To provide a fully developed stream line at three different flow velocity cases, the WBC diameter and distance of connection should be larger than 1050mm and longer than 300mm, respectively.
